A few unrelated points in no particular order:
1) Either my clocks are all wrong or the BBC decided to put this on a couple of minutes early. Oh well, I presume there wasn't anything particularly amazing before the credits.
2) I hope the Tereleptils will make a comeback before too long, then they can destroy the sonic screwdriver/magic wand again.
3) While they are at it they can quietly dispose of Murray Gold too and save us from the incessant, intrusive and, above all, crap incidental music. Bring back Keff McCulloch, at least he had the decency to not score 100% of the screen time.
4) It seems to me that if the Doctor, Donna and that reporter hadn't got involved nothing bad would have happened at all. Millions of people would have lost the fat they wanted and been none the wiser, the alien fat people would have got all the children they wanted.Everything would have been fine.
5) On a related note, exactly when did the Doctor's character change from a guy who just travels around to see things, to a guy who actively goes around looking for "crimes" to solve.
6) Was Rose made up to look about 10 years older, or has Billie Piper just been overdoing it lately?
7) Does anyone else think it would have been nice for next week's story to just have been an old-fashioned historical adventure, without the need for a bunch of aliens getting involved as usual?
